CS/CS/HB 615: Individual Education Plans
GENERAL BILL by Education Administration Subcommittee ; Student Academic Success Subcommittee ; Tendrich ; (CO-INTRODUCERS) Basabe ; Gerwig ; Trabulsy
Individual Education Plans; Revises requirements for school districts relating to determination of eligibility, implementation, & accountability for student IEPs; provides that parent has right to access, upon request, service logs within specified timeframe; requires IEP team to inform parents of such right; requires each school district to provide individualized orientation to parent of student newly identified to be eligible for exceptional student education services; requires school district to obtain signed acknowledgement from each parent; provides requirements for orientation & acknowledgement; requires school districts to notify parents of available refresher orientations each year; requires that certain information be retained in student's education records; requires school districts to develop standardized services logs for provisions of specified services for use by specified persons.
